## Support

Offline mode in the Tarnwick field-survey app caches up to 500 survey responses locally and syncs when connectivity returns. Known limitation: photo attachments over 10 MB are deferred to the next full sync. Release builds must be verified against the offline regression checklist before sign-off. For sync conflicts or checklist questions, contact the mobile support rotation.

alerts address for kajog-tadup: druox@plorvanet.internal

## Break-Glass Access: Tollgate Session Refresh Bug

Tollgate's session-token refresh occasionally invalidates admin sessions mid-deploy, locking the release manager out of the Driftwell console. If this happens during a cutover, use the break-glass account rather than waiting for the refresh cycle. The account bypasses the token service entirely and is audited by the Pallas team. To unlock it, enter the passphrase below at the emergency prompt.

unlock words, kagef-taduf: fenir-quenix-norwyn-sorvan-gormir-gorir-fraok

**Config Hot-Reload — Support Quickstart**

Quillgate reloads config without restarts. Edits to flags in Panelbox propagate within 30 seconds; no ticket needed. If a customer reports stale settings, check the reload counter on the Quillgate status page first. Counter frozen? Escalate to the platform rotation — do not bounce the service yourself, it drops active sessions. To query the reload counter directly, hit the internal metrics endpoint with the key below.

API key for yahig-tadup: kto7_ubizbYm